Powell River Airport planned shutdown: April 8 to June 9, 2024

From April 8 to June 9, 2024, the Powell River Airport is undergoing a planned shutdown to make upgrades to the runway.

During this time, patient safety, care and continuity of services remain our top priority. Due to the temporary closure, Vancouver Coastal Health (VCH) is implementing several operational adjustments regarding qathet General Hospital (qGH) patient transfers, transportation of referred-out lab specimens, and staff and medical staff travel.

VCH is working with BC Emergency Health Services (BCEHS) to add additional helicopter services to transport those patients who would normally travel by fixed-wing air ambulance. High priority patients will continue to be transported by BCEHS helicopter.

Patients who are medically stable and returning to the qathet Region from other hospitals will return by helicopter or ground transport, as per usual processes. If inclement weather prevents air travel in or out of Powell River, VCH will follow BCEHS’ established protocol.

As Pacific Coastal Air will be unable to fly into Powell River during this time, Harbour Air is adding  float plane flights to Vancouver Harbour and YVR South Terminal seven days a week. 

While qGH Lab Services will continue to complete the majority of patient specimen testing onsite, lab samples that require testing in the Lower Mainland will be sent via ground courier during this time. Routine blood products from Canadian blood services will continue to be shipped by ground transport, and urgent requests will be transported on Harbour Air, as needed.

The Immunization Clinic at Powell River Community Health Centre provides seasonal and routine vaccinations, protecting us from the effects of a number of serious vaccine-preventable infections and diseases like polio, diphtheria, measles and rubella.

How to access

  • Check eligibility and vaccine schedule

  • Book an appointment

    For routine adult immunizations, please see your local pharmacist.

    Call us at (604) 485-3310 to book a routine immunization appointment for infants, toddlers, children starting kindergarten, school-age immunizations and adults with medical conditions and complex immunization needs. 

  • Prepare for the appointment

    • For children under 2 years old, we invite you to arrive 15 minutes early to weigh and measure your child prior to your appointment time.
    • If your child has been immunized at a physician’s office or out of the province, we may not have the record of those immunizations. Submit your health record online or call us to report those immunizations at least 48 hours before your appointment. Without a current immunization history, we may need to use your appointment time for planning and may need to book a separate appointment for immunization due to time constraints.
    • Bring your Child Health Passport or immunization record for your child to the appointment.

Getting here by ferry

qathet General Hospital is two ferry rides away from the City of Vancouver.

Take the Langdale ferry from the Horseshoe Bay Terminal.  Ferry schedules can be found at: http://bcferries.com. Drive up the Sunshine Coast along Hwy 101 from Langdale to Earl's Cove.  Take the Saltery Bay ferry from Earl's Cove.

From the Saltery Bay ferry terminal, travel along Hwy 101 for approximately 20 km until you reach a "Welcome to Powell River" sign.  Continue inside the city limits until you reach a street with a right-hand lane and a store/gas station called Pacific Point Market.  At the corner on your right, turn right.  You are now on Joyce Avenue.  Follow Joyce Avenue through four sets of stoplights.  Approximately 1 km past the fourth light, you will approach the hospital on the right.

qathet General Hospital

qathet General Hospital (formerly Powell River General Hospital) is a 33-bed facility providing services that include surgery, endoscopy, ICU, obstetrics, in-patient psychiatry, oncology, emergency and diagnostic services.
